![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 20 Pomógł: 0 Dołączył: 6.05.2003 Ostrzeżenie: (0%) ![]() ![]() |
Jak wrzucic do kolejnych zmiennych zm2, zm2 ... wszystkie pliki w katalogu (na srvie) z rozszerzeniem .usr?? i jeszcze do zmiennej np. $zmi ich ilosc??
|
|
|
![]() |
![]()
Post
#2
|
|
Administrator planeta/IRC Grupa: Przyjaciele php.pl Postów: 385 Pomógł: 0 Dołączył: 19.04.2003 Skąd: Zabrze Ostrzeżenie: (0%) ![]() ![]() |
Napisałem kiedyś prostą funkcje (korzystając z komentarzy w manualu) która wrzuca pliki z danego katalogu do tablicy i ją zwraca:
[php:1:0cbc648442]<?php function array_dir($dir_name = '.'){ $dir = opendir($dir_name); $i = 0; while($file = readdir($dir)){ if($i > 1) $array_dir[$i] = $plik; $i++; } closedir($dir); return $array_dir; } ?>[/php:1:0cbc648442] Dwa pierwsze 'pliki' są pomijane, bo są to '.' i '..' :] Żeby wyświetlić pliki z folderu np. pliki, wystarczy taki kod: [php:1:0cbc648442]<?php $pliki = array_dir('pliki'); foreach($pliki as $plik){ echo "$plik<BR>n"; } ?>[/php:1:0cbc648442] Ilość plików można uzyskać używająć funkcji count(): [php:1:0cbc648442]<?php $ilosc = count($pliki); ?>[/php:1:0cbc648442] |
|
|
![]() ![]() |
![]() |
Aktualny czas: 4.10.2025 - 20:42 |